Biobase Hot Plate Magnetic Stirrer Hotplate Magnetic Stirrer Automatic Liquid Magnetic Stirrer 206612

Biobase Hot Plate Magnetic Stirrer Hotplate Magnetic Stirrer Automatic Liquid Magnetic Stirrer